Digital technologies are becoming increasingly important to arts and humanities
research, expanding the horizons of research methods in all aspects of data
capture, investigation, analysis, modelling, presentation and dissemination. this
important series will cover a wide range of disciplines with each volume focusing
on a particular area, identifying the ways in which technology impacts on specific
subjects. The aim is to provide an authoritative reflection of the ‘state of the art’
in the application of computing and technology. the series will be critical reading
for experts in digital humanities and technology issues, and it will also be of wide
interest to all scholars working in humanities and arts research.
